A typical day for a Camp Crew member involves supporting various camp functions such as setting up activity areas, maintaining cleanliness of facilities, assisting with meal service, and helping with general logistics. Responsibilities may shift depending on the camp’s schedule, special events, or weather conditions, so adaptability is key. Camp Crew often works closely with counselors, kitchen staff, and management to ensure campers have a safe and enjoyable experience. The role is both hands-on and social, offering variety and the opportunity to build strong teamwork skills. Many find the work rewarding, especially when contributing directly to the camp’s smooth operation and camper satisfaction.
